metagon's Introduction

Metagon does a lot. From bringing you the nicest pictures, to providing you the best tools, and giving you the best fun!

  • Search 9gag posts, or get a random post in a section
  • Random animal pics
  • Search anime pics from major boorus and Pixiv
  • Search pics from Imgur and Flickr
  • Minecraft tools for servers and users
  • Bitly tools

and more coming up!

Like you, I built a GroupMe bot as a fun project, but became frustrated with the limitations of GroupMe's bot infrastructure. As you know, GroupMe has no straightforward way to run a bot in multiple groups. The simple system of maintaining a constant bot ID seriously limits how useful GroupMe bots can be, and leaves GroupMe lagging behind other platforms like Discord in this area.

So, I developed the bot management and indexing system GroupMe has been missing (and massively upgraded it in recent weeks). MeBots acts as a middleman to the GroupMe API and injects extra fields into the message POST sent from GroupMe, i.e. the bot ID and user token that can be used in the group where the message was sent. All you need is to register your bot and tweak your code to use the received bot ID and token rather than constants. With this minor tweak, anyone could go to https://mebots.io/bot/groupmebot and click just a couple buttons to add the bot to their own groups.
